Output 85189c6cb4f538874f8ad8e1137903d3cae76c890ae18650debad8fa62e95186:0

value
21424203
script pubkey
OP_0 OP_PUSHBYTES_20 bb667d226532575fd244cbc1bd9a8b91bf685e70
address
bc1qhdn86gn9xft4l5jye0qmmx5tjxlkshnsxu0cm9
transaction
85189c6cb4f538874f8ad8e1137903d3cae76c890ae18650debad8fa62e95186
spent
true